Poor Material Option



When it involves roofing setup, choosing the incorrect products can lead to pricey problems down the line. You might assume that any roof covering material will certainly do, but that's a common false impression. It's crucial to pick products that match your regional climate and the certain demands of your home.

For example, if you reside in an area with heavy rainfall or snow, going with asphalt tiles may not be the most effective option. Rather, consider more sturdy options like steel or slate.

Additionally, focus on the top quality of the products you're considering. Cheap products may save you cash upfront, however they commonly do not have long life and can lead to frequent fixings or substitutes.


You must also think of the style of your home and make sure the products you choose will preserve its aesthetic charm.

Ultimately, do not neglect to seek advice from professionals. They can supply beneficial insights and advise materials that adhere to regional building regulations.

Spending time in correct product selection currently can assist you avoid headaches and expenses in the future, making your roof project a success.

Inadequate Flashing Setup



Selecting the appropriate products isn't the only element that can lead to roof covering issues; insufficient blinking setup can likewise develop considerable problems. Flashing is essential for guiding water away from susceptible areas, such as smokeshafts, skylights, and roof covering valleys. If it's not installed appropriately, you risk water invasion, which can lead to mold growth and structural damage.

When you set up flashing, ensure it's the best kind for your roof's design and the local environment. As an example, metal blinking is frequently much more long lasting than plastic in locations with heavy rainfall or snow. Ensure the flashing overlaps appropriately and is safeguarded firmly to prevent spaces where water can permeate via.

You need to also pay attention to the setup angle. Flashing ought to be positioned to guide water away from your house, not towards it.

If you're uncertain about the installment procedure or the products needed, get in touch with a professional. They can assist identify the best flashing choices and make certain whatever is set up properly, protecting your home from prospective water damage.

Taking these steps can save you time, cash, and headaches later on.

If you don't mount adequate air flow, you're setting your roof covering up for failing.

To avoid this error, first, evaluate your home's details ventilation needs. A well balanced system normally includes both consumption and exhaust vents to promote air flow. Ensure you've mounted soffit vents along the eaves and ridge vents at the peak of your roof covering. This mix allows hot air to leave while cooler air gets in, maintaining your attic room space comfortable.
